ISLAMABAD:The   efforts of the National Assembly’s Standing Committee on Inter-Provincial Coordination for holding a Quaid-e-Azam Trophy match and other cricket activities at Bugti Stadium in Quetta were acknowledged on Friday. The sixth meeting of the parliamentary panel, presided over Agha Hassan Baloch, was held at the Parliament House.  It was observed that cricket events in Quetta would not only encourage the game at the grass-roots level but also help in attracting international cricket to the country. The panel also appreciated the proposed visit of the Federal Minister Dr Fahmida Mirza to Quetta in the coming week for inaugurating various sports-related projects. The panel called for the restructuring of the Inter Board Committee of Chairman (IBCC) to increase its capacity. It unanimously confirmed the minutes of its previous meeting held on August 23.
